Python 如何使用pip更新或升级软件包
在本文中,我们将介绍如何使用pip工具来更新或升级Python软件包。pip是一个Python包管理器,用于安装、升级和删除Python软件包。
阅读更多:Python 教程
什么是pip?
pip是一个Python第三方包管理器,它是Python标准库中的一部分。通过pip可以方便地安装、升级和删除Python软件包。pip具有良好的用户界面和易于使用的命令行工具,使得管理Python软件包变得非常简单。
如何更新pip?
在使用pip之前,我们首先需要确保pip本身是最新的版本。我们可以通过以下命令来更新pip:
执行该命令后,pip将会检查当前pip的版本,并自动安装最新版本。
如何使用pip更新软件包?
要使用pip更新一个Python软件包,我们可以使用以下命令:
其中,package_name
是要更新的软件包的名称。执行该命令后,pip将会检查当前软件包的版本,并自动安装最新版本。
举个例子,如果我们想要更新numpy软件包,我们可以执行以下命令:
如何使用pip升级所有已安装的软件包?
如果我们想要一次性升级所有已安装的软件包,可以使用以下命令:
执行该命令后,pip将会列出所有已安装但不是最新版本的软件包,并自动逐个更新这些软件包。
如何查看已安装的软件包的版本?
要查看已安装的软件包的版本,可以使用以下命令:
执行该命令后,pip将会列出所有已安装的软件包及其对应的版本号。
如何降级软件包的版本?
如果我们想要降级一个软件包的版本,可以使用以下命令:
其中,package_name
是要降级的软件包的名称,desired_version
是要降级到的版本号。执行该命令后,pip将会检查当前软件包的版本,并自动安装指定的版本。
举个例子,如果我们想要降级numpy软件包到1.18.5版本,我们可以执行以下命令:
总结
本文介绍了如何使用pip工具来更新或升级Python软件包。我们首先学习了pip是什么以及如何更新pip本身。然后,我们学习了如何使用pip来更新单个软件包、一次性升级所有软件包以及降级软件包的版本。通过正确使用pip,我们可以轻松管理Python软件包的版本,并确保我们始终使用最新的软件包。希望本文对你有所帮助!